Joe Biden signs sweeping order to regulate AI in U.S, days before Sunak’s AI safety summit

File photo of U.S. President Joe Biden. | Photo Credit: Reuters U.S. President Joe Biden, on Monday, signed an executive order to enable wide-ranging regulation of artificial intelligence (AI). Mr Biden’s order comes days before U.K. Prime Minister Rishi Sunak’s AI Safety Summit in Bletchley Park, as countries race to keep up with rapidly evolving…
